Hideki, a Rank C adventurer, was out on his first big quest after his recent promotion. Adrenaline coarsed through his veins as he cut through one of the many undead that had overrun the small town of Whitegrove. All of his time killing low level monsters near the guild hall and completing the random fetch requests that they had found for him finally was going to pay off. He was going to get to be a hero.
He had been dispatched with two others and they were to discover the source of the undead scourge and eliminate it. The likely culprit was a crypt master or if they were really unlucky maybe a necromancer. He sliced his way through two more undead and pressed forward.
"They seem to be coming from the cemetary, but we need to get these people out of here. It will run out of corpses eventually." Vladimir stepped up beside him holding a scepter in his hand that glowed with a white light.
"I'll cut my way over there. Keep helping with the evacuation. We need to take out the source." Hideki said.
"No. We stick together. Let's go after we get everyone out of the city."
Hideki had no intention of taking this task on in a passive way. He would go for the enemy's throat. Vladimir pointed his scepter towards a group of undead that were chasing a small boy down the street and bolts of holy energy flew from it. Upon impact, the undead collapsed to the ground after being bathed in a holy light.
They have this well in hand. I'm going to go alone. If I can do this singlehandedly, then maybe they'll promote me again and I can leave this area for bigger and better things. Maybe even some good looking ladies will want to reward me for saving their town?
He grinned at the thought and ran off towards the cemetary, ignoring the rest of his party that were yelling for him to stay. They were being idiots. The only way to get rid of an undead horde like this wasn't to kill them one by one. Finding the source of the scourge and eliminating it was the best way to do so. If they wanted to stay back and evacuate individual people, then he would take care of business alone.
The cemetary in this town lie up a hill and he had to fight his way through a horde of the half rotted corpses on his way before he finally reached the base of the hill. At his current level of skill, he felt that he could kill a large number of these things without even tiring. They didn't even have weapons or anything, so he had reach on them as well. So long as he didn't let them swarm him, there wouldn't be a problem.

Ahead he saw a group of ten undead swarming around a screaming woman. He stepped closer and held his sword vertically above his head, activating one of his skills; Shockwave. Energy that was fueled by his mana began to buzz around the blade of his sword and after a moment he slashed at the air, allowing the energy to be released. The Shockwave cut through the air and into the group of undead. He was too late to save the woman, but his attack shredded a half dozen of the enemies.
Undead that were covered in fresh blood turned to him and charged in a frenzy. Hideki grinned and met them, brining a final death to each as his blade cut through enemy after enemy.
Once the group of weaklings was gone, he turned his attention back to the top of the hill where he now saw something different than all the other undead he had seen before. A humanoid figure stood at the top of the hill in black armor with a sword. The eyes of the armored enemy glowed with a green light. He watched as it pointed at varoius gravesites and then undead crawled out of the ground. This was his target, and it appeared to be a necromancer.
Not wanting it to gain more pawns to send at him he charged up the small incline with a roar. Hideki ran his hand over his blade as he went and cast Holy Blade. The sword in his hand emitted a faint white glow and any undead who came to meet him on his way up the hill fell with ease to the enchanted blade. The necromancer drew a large two handed sword from its back and engaged him. Steel met steel in the cool evening air and Hideki had to admit that this fighter was far more deadly than the unarmed enemies that he and his party had fought thus far.
The heavy blade smashed into his and he had to use all of his strength just to not have his weapon knocked out of his hands. It was time to use another of his skills. He stepped back and activated the sword style, Tiger Stance. The aggressive sword stance skill allowed him to fight more fiercly than he had before and he charged back in with a flurry of blows. The necromancer was clearly not a very good swordsman, and in moments he had bashed away the enemy's weapon and had knocked the necromancer onto the ground. In just the few seconds that it had taken to perform his flurry of attacks, he had won the day. The necromancer tried to get back up, but Hideki stepped in closer and slammed his blade down into the eye slit of the enemy's helmet. The necromancer's body went limp almost instantly and he looked around warily.

Did it work?
He looked down the hill and saw a few of the raised undead fall to the ground.
I did it! I'm a fucking hero! Vladimir will have to eat his priest hat after this one!
He stood triumphantly over the dead enemy and grinned. *Ding*
Congratulations! You have reached level 9!
+1 TP
“Sweet! That’s how it’s done! The guild’s going to have to promote me to Rank B for sure after this! I literally saved this town!"
He couldn't wait to get back to the guild hall, get his promotion, and then head off to bigger and better things. No more fetch quests, no more Werehare subjugation. He would finally be able to leave the region and make a name for himself. He did a little dance over the corpse to celebrate.
You have been hit with Eldritch Blast!
Critical Blow
-300 HP
Stunned!
Hideki found himself face down on the ground and his back exploded with pain. His legs were on top of the corpse he had been celebrating over and he could feel his back burning. He was helpless and unable to scream due to his stunned status. As it was, he could only stare at the grass of the graveyard in the moonlit night as he slowly died from the continuous damage of the attack.
You suffer from burns!
-25 HP
Fuck! Is this really how it ends? No ladies, no fortune, not even a chance to make a name for myself as a hero?
You suffer from burns!
-25 HP
The last thing he saw before everything went dark was the sight of some girl’s feet as she stepped up next to him. The frills of her white and black dress hung down to her ankles and he could see her simple white shoes. From what he could tell from his position on the ground, he had just been killed by a fucking child. His eyes closed and he breathed out his final breath.
You suffer from burns!
-25 HP
You have died!
Suddenly, he found himself standing in a tunnel of white light. His pain was gone and he looked around. There was nothing behind him except a deep, neverending darkness. It didn't take a genius to realize that he did not want to go that way. He stepped towards the light at the end of the tunnel.
So this is it, huh? This is how it all ends? I died without ever even accomplishing anything.
He sighed to himself as he continued walking. The tunnel was surprisingly long.
Maybe next time I’m born into the world, I’ll be a better, less selfish person. It’s said the gods give people second chances, that can’t be all made up, right?
As he continued toward the light he saw the figure of a beautiful, blonde haired woman with delicate, white wings appear ahead of him. She was quite literally the girl of his dreams. She had a large chest and a welcoming smile on her face.
Then again, maybe staying dead and not getting reincarnated wouldn't be so bad after all.
He grinned. Once he was a little closer, the angel began to speak to him in a melodic voice, “Welcome to the after—”
She was cut off mid sentence and he suddenly felt a powerful pressure gripping his very soul. He let out a scream and felt as something appeared around the neck of his ethereal form. It was a choker with a glowing red ruby attached at the center. He tried to rip the thing off his neck but when he touched it, it burned.
What the fuck?
Despite the pain, he made himself try to rip the thing off, but it wasn't going to happen. A moment later, he was yanked back down the tunnel by an invisible cord.
“No!” he screamed.
You have been afflicted by Soul Trap!
Your immortal soul has been bound to the living world in service of Megumi the Necromancer!
His spirit smashed back into the lifeless corpse that was once his body. His head ached and he found that he could move again. He sat up and looked around warily. There were two things that he noticed:
Not much time had passed. The undead corpses still littered the ground nearby. A girl, maybe fifteen years old or so, with long silver hair, pale skin, and violet eyes was crouched down next to him with a wicked grin on her face.
“Hello there. I’m Megumi, and you get to be my new toy.”
Fuck my life, he thought as he tried unsuccessfully to make his body reach over to strangle her.
